A note for you arch, if someone gets an error about a corrupted file, it is ALWAYS because of a download error. Occasionally, downloads just break, and assume they are done, which will give an error if you try to use it. It's more common on slow connections, and using an inbrowser download manager, such as firefox's has a higher chance of breaking than if you use a download manager such as the firefox plugin, downloadthemall, or an external download manager like 'free download manager' (honestly, everyone needs FPM, its the best! Makes sense, with all the AWARDS its won!).

Either way, corrupted files always just need a redownload. Worst case scenario is the file was uploaded to the web server corrupted, in which case you would need to contact the webmaster an have them reupload it.
